The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Adams, born in 1852 in St Albans, Hertfordshire, consisted of 6 members. James was the head of the household, married to Amelia C Adams, born in 1855 in Hoxton, Middlesex, England. They had 2 children; James W (born 1878 in Hornsey, Middlesex, England) and Hartnell G (born 1879 in Islington, Middlesex, England).
During the period, also present in the household were James's Boarder, William J (born 1858 in Cambridgeshire, England) and James's Boarder, Walter G (born 1861 in Hammersmith, Middlesex, England).
